Leslie C. Moore, 66, of Six Orchid Ave. Moundsville, died Friday, Oct. 29, 1982, in Reynolds Memorial Hospital, Glen Dale .He was a retired employee of Triangel PWC .and a veteran of World War II. surviving are his wife,
Florence Midcap Moore ; five sons, Leslie, Johnny, James, Roger and Billy all of Moundsville ; two daughters, Sarah and Linda Midcap. both at home ; a stepdaughter, Donna Crabtree of Somerset , Ky; four brothers, Harley of Hedgesville , W V. Norman of Hundred, Austin of Wetzel County and John of New Cumberland; five grandchildren. Friends were received at the Crisell Funeral home .400 Jefferson Ave . Moundsville where services were held 10 am Monday. Interment in Moore Cemetery, Wetzel County .

[Note249] OBITUARY
Mascillar Wheeler Moore, aged about seventy years, after a briefillness, passed
to her home on high February 26, 1906, from the home of her nephew, FrankWilliams,
Shadyside. For many years she had been a devout chrlstian and was amember of South
Bellaire M. E, church at death, when in the valley her faith wasconquering, hope bright
and peace abounding, Quietly she was released from her clay palace todepart to her
heavenly mansion, Her husband preceded her by many years, She leaves tomourn her,
four children, three step children, and a host of friends. Her funeraltook place in the M.
E. church, R. W. Martin officiating, Wednesday, at 10:00 a. m. Intermentin Davis
cemetery.
